No 4 Pairc Na gCaor a truly delightful property tucked away in a quiet cul-de-sac in Moycullen's, located in the heart of the village. This property over the years has been fully renovated, it is exceptionally well presented and tastefully decorated throughout making it the ideal family home. The accommodation consists of a bright entrance hallway with beautiful solid wood flooring. The arched window allows light to flood through this space. The hallway leads into the living room with a open fireplace with feature wall and bespoke window seating and storage, the perfect place to relax in the evenings to the backdrop of the beautiful mature garden. The kitchen/dining area positioned to the right of the entrance hallway spans the full width of the house. The kitchen area with ample fitted units sits against the attractive tiling which works beautifully with the overhead units. The dining area finished in a solid wood floor and open fireplace which overlooks the garden. The ground floor accommodation is completed by a downstairs bedroom, a bright and spacious room with fitted storage units which overlooks the front garden. This room could be used as a large study or home office if desired. Ascending the carpeted staircase to the first floor, there are two large double bedrooms. Both span from front to the back of the property, one on each side of the landing. The master bedroom located to the right has excellent wall of storage finished in louvre doors. The other bedroom is filled with light from the over head velux window. Both rooms are finished in wooden flooring. The family bathroom leads from the landing also and is tastefully decorated with classic tiling which shines under the overhead velux. The hot press with further storage complete the first floor accommodation. Externally, this property's beautiful rear garden which was designed by the award winning designer & columnist Anne Byrne featured on RTE's Supergarden show in 2011. Anne made the most of this outside space with her thoughtful design and attention to detail making this space a haven of tranquility, beautifully planted with an abundance of trees, flowers and shrubs. Steps lead you towards a circular patio area positioned at the bottom of the garden which makes the most of the morning & afternoon sun and the ideal spot to enjoy a BBQ & garden party. The garden shed provides ample storage space. To the front a green lawn runs along the driveway to the front paving where a low fence wall bounds the property. Páirc Na gCaor is a mature residential development of various house types located in the heart of Moycullen Village. This tree lined estate is very well maintained and is very popular both with those looking to down size and with young families starting out in life. The location of this property will not disappoint with such convenience to all of Moycullen village's amenities such as shops, cafes, restaurants, bars, church and local schools & playground to name but a few.
